'The ultimate book on the creative skills of journalism' - Writing MagazineUseful and timely... it is refreshing to discover a book so overtly designed to inspire students to think about what can make writing good - or even great. - Media International AustraliaThis is a book about the art of writing for newspapers and magazine, but doesnt look at punctuation, spelling and the stylistic conventions of everyday journalism. Instead, Good Writing For Journalists presents extended examples of writing which are powerful, memorable, colourful or funny. Each piece will be contextualised and analysed encouraging readers to learn from the best practitioners.This book will inspire those who want to make their writing individual and memorable. Along the way the major elements of non-fiction writing will be introduced, in chapters organised by genre - profile writing, reportage, news analysis, investigation, sports writing, personal and opinion columns and lifestyle among them. Phillips book sees itself as a natural successor to Wolfe & Johnsons seminal The New Journalism (1975). By adopting a larger sweeping and tailoring itself for the contemporary journalistic arena, this book will be an essential purchase for the discerning journalist and journalism student.
